Mount Fuji , or Fugaku, located on the island of Honshū, is the highest mountain in Japan, with a summit elevation of 3,776.24 m (12,389 ft 3 in). It is the second-highest volcano located on an island in Asia (after Mount Kerinci on the island of Sumatra), and seventh-highest peak of an island on Earth. WebMount Fuji rises 3,776 meters above sea level and is Japan's tallest mountain. It was also the inspiration for a series of famous ukiyo-e (woodblock prints) by artist Katsushika Hokusai. In recognition of its global significance, Mount Fuji and the area surrounding it were designated a UNESCO World Heritage site in 2013.
